A protein family defined by the presence of three ZINC FINGER domains, one of which is a RING FINGER DOMAIN, a coiled-coil region, and a highly variable C-terminal region. They function in many cellular processes including APOPTOSIS and CELL CYCLE regulation. . 0.68

A UBIQUITIN editing enzyme that functions as both a ubiquitin ligase and deubiquitinase. It contains several ZINC FINGERS and functions in the immune response and INFLAMMATION by modulating signals from TNF-ALPHA; IL1-BETA; or pathogens via TOLL-LIKE RECEPTORS to terminate NF-KAPPA B activity. . 0.65

A tumor necrosis factor receptor family member that is specific for RANK LIGAND and plays a role in bone homeostasis by regulating osteoclastogenesis. It is also expressed on DENDRITIC CELLS where it plays a role in regulating dendritic cell survival. Signaling by the activated receptor occurs through its association with TNF RECEPTOR-ASSOCIATED FACTORS. . 0.58

Tripartite Motif-Containing Protein 28. TRIM28 Protein . Tripartite Motif Containing Protein 28 . A tripartite motif protein consisting of an N-terminal RING finger, two B-box type ZINC FINGERS, and C-terminal PHD domain. It functions as a transcriptional repressor by associating with Kruppel-association box domain (KRAB domain) transcription factors and has E3-SUMO-ligase activity towards itself and also sumoylates INTERFERON REGULATORY FACTOR-7 to reduce its activity as a transcriptional activator. It can also function as a ubiquitin protein ligase towards TUMOR SUPPRESSOR PROTEIN P53. . 0.57
Promyelocytic Leukemia Protein. RNF71 Protein . TRIM19 Protein . A tripartite motif protein that contains three ZINC FINGERS, including a RING FINGER DOMAIN, at its N-terminal. Several nuclear and one cytoplasmic isoforms result from alternative splicing of the PML gene; most nuclear isoforms localize to subnuclear structures (PML nuclear bodies) that are disrupted in ACUTE PROMYELOCYTIC LEUKEMIA cells. . 0.57
